Disney Park Pass Basics
Disney Park Passes are a fairly new addition to Walt Disney World, but it seems like they are here to stay.

In order to get into a park in Disney World, guests must make a Disney Park Pass reservation for each day in the park that they want to visit. Before the shutdown in March 2020, guests simply needed to purchase a ticket to be able to visit the parks– now, it takes an extra step.

Halloween
Disney’s After Hours BOO Bash is the new Halloween event for 2021. Attending Disney’s Halloween events is a beloved tradition by many Disney fans, so Halloween is a popular time to visit Walt Disney World.

You can expect October 31st park pass reservations to fill up quickly, but keep in mind that if you’re only planning on visiting the Magic Kingdom in the evening for BOO Bash, you don’t need to reserve a park pass!

Thanksgiving
Thanksgiving week is another popular time for people to visit Walt Disney World. In general, pretty much any time there is a school break, you can expect the parks to fill up a little more — most parents try to avoid pulling their kids out of school during the year!

If you’re planning a vacation to Disney World at the end of November, be sure to book your Thanksgiving Day Park Pass Reservations as soon as you can.
